Income Statistics Overview
| Metric | Jennings County | Indiana Avg | US Average |
|---|---|---|---|
| Median Household Income | $68,837 | $70,132 | $78,145 |
| Median Personal Income | $50,061 | $56,502 | $61,726 |
| Average income growth | 5.4% | 4.8% | 5.1% |
| Six-Figure Earners | 4.2% | 9.6% | 13.2% |
The median household income in Jennings County is about 2% lower than in Indiana. Income has been growing faster in Jennings County (5.4%/yr) than in Indiana (4.8%/yr).
About 4% of adults in Jennings County earn six figures ($100,000 or more) a year, lower than the Indiana average of 10%.
Median Household Income 2009–2023 Trend
Median Household Income Over Time
Median household income in Jennings County, Indiana grew by 60.2% from 2009 to 2023, reaching $68,837 in 2023. That's an average of about 5.4% per year.
Economic Inequality in Jennings County | Gender Pay Gap | Gini Coefficient
| Metric | Jennings County | Indiana Avg | US Average |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gini Coefficient | 0.487 | 0.544 | 0.570 |
| Male Median Income | $57,474 | $63,558 | $67,746 |
| Female Median Income | $45,878 | $49,036 | $54,793 |
| Gender Pay Gap | 20.2% | 22.8% | 19.1% |
The Gini coefficient measures how evenly income is shared between richer and poorer households, from 0 (everyone earns the same) to 1 (one household earns nearly everything). The lower the number, the more equally income is distributed. In Jennings County, it is 0.487, lower than Indiana's 0.544, so income is more evenly distributed here than there, and lower than the US's 0.570, so income is more evenly distributed here than there.
Men's income is about 25% more than women's income in Jennings County, Indiana. Over a 35-year career, a 25% wage gap accumulates to roughly $405,860 in unearned income for female workers in the area.
Income by Sex Over Time
Since 2009, the income gap between men and women in Jennings County, Indiana has narrowed from about 25% to 20% in 2023. In dollar terms, the gap has widened by $1,806 since 2009.
Employment
| Metric | Jennings County | Indiana Avg | US Average |
|---|---|---|---|
| Unemployment Rate | 4.3% | 4.3% | 5.2% |
| Working from Home | 4.1% | 9.6% | 13.4% |
| Commute time (minutes) | 22 | 21 | 22 |
Approximately 588 people are unemployed in Jennings County, Indiana.
The average commute time in Jennings County is 22 minutes, longer than the 21 minutes in Indiana.
Unemployment Rate Over Time
Since 2011, the unemployment rate in Jennings County, Indiana has fallen from 14.3% to 4.3% in 2023.
